NFX1‐123: A potential therapeutic target in cervical cancer

Sreenivasulu Chintala,
Maura A. Dankoski,
Anand Anbarasu
et al.

Abstract: NFX1‐123 is a splice variant isoform of the NFX1 gene. It is highly expressed in cervical cancers caused by HPV, and NFX1‐123 is a protein partner with the HPV oncoprotein E6. Together, NFX1‐123 and E6 affect cellular growth, longevity, and differentiation. The expression status of NFX1‐123 in cancers beyond cervical and head and neck cancers, and its potential as therapeutic target, have not been investigated.
